    Summary of reviews

    Home of the Good Shepherd – Malta is described by many families as a small, community-oriented facility with a strong emphasis on social engagement and a welcoming culture. Reviewers frequently highlight friendly, compassionate staff who build close relationships with residents; a busy activities calendar centered on musical performances (notably a grand piano), crafts, baking, and regular outings; and well-maintained, park-like grounds that provide accessible outdoor walking spaces. The building offers a mix of unit types, including private rooms and two-room suites, and several reviewers praised smooth admissions and move-in support, on-site nursing (RN/LPN) coverage, medication administration, and available hospice services.

    At the same time, recurrent operational concerns appear across reviews. Staffing levels and staff continuity are common themes: families reported chronic understaffing, reliance on agency personnel (especially on weekends), and the resultant variability in care quality. Management instability and turnover were also cited, with some families describing policy changes that affected visitation and pet policies. Several reviewers raised concerns about staff training and conduct; there are isolated allegations of inappropriate physical interactions that prospective families should inquire about directly with administrators and regulators.

    Clinical-safety and care-delivery patterns merit careful attention during a tour. Multiple accounts point to weaknesses in fall-prevention and post-fall response (including delayed alarm responses), inconsistent medication practices (including use of psychotropic medications in some cases), and uneven care standards in the enhanced/memory-care areas compared with the general assisted-living units. Reviewers also noted incidents where residents had difficulty accessing meals, contributing to weight loss or reduced intake; these describe broader issues with meal-service continuity and resident support during dining times that families should evaluate.

    Dining and facilities present a mixed picture. Many residents and families described decent to very good meals and a pleasant dining environment, while others noted declines after staff changes and occasional food-access problems. The facility is characterized as older and smaller by some, though generally well-kept and clean, with planned updates mentioned. Activity spaces, a beauty parlor, and communal areas such as piano rooms are commonly praised, but living units are sometimes described as compact, and memory-care areas may feel more institutional to certain observers.

    In summary, Home of the Good Shepherd – Malta offers a warm, socially active environment with several operational strengths—engaging programming, attentive long-term staff relationships, on-site nursing and hospice, and attractive grounds. However, persistent concerns about staffing levels and consistency, management turnover, emergency-response reliability, fall prevention, and some aspects of medication and meal management create variability in the resident experience. Prospective residents and families should tour the community, ask for current staffing ratios and agency usage, review fall-prevention and alarm-response protocols, request recent incident and corrective-action histories, and confirm policies on visitation, pets, and memory-care staffing before making a placement decision.

    About Home of the Good Shepherd – Malta

    Home of the Good Shepherd - Malta is a senior living community in Malta, New York with 86 beds, and is part of the Home of The Good Shepherd network. The place offers assisted living, enhanced assisted living, and memory care, with skilled nursing and home care service options. There's a focus on keeping things warm and home-like, so you'll find both private and shared accommodations, with studio and one-bedroom floor plans, all furnished and featuring private bathrooms, air conditioning, cable TV, phone service, Wi-Fi, and kitchenettes. There are 44 different floor plans, which lets residents choose what fits them best, and there are both private suites and shared rooms available to suit various needs. The staff handles all the regular chores like housekeeping, laundry, dry cleaning, and upkeep, and there's 24-hour support, supervision, and a call system for emergencies, so residents don't have to worry if something happens. Enhanced assisted living means folks can age in place, with skilled care like help with moving around, transferring, managing blood sugar, or using catheters.

    Residents have personalized care plans, designed to match needs and routines, and there's a high staff-to-resident ratio, with RN Care Managers, LPNs, and aides with special dementia care training available round the clock. Memory care programs use a high level of attention, focus on comfort, and even special programs using the five senses for communication, while also managing behavioral changes in a calm and steady way. The supportive community environment, dedicated Assistant Administrator, and a team of friendly, helpful staff work year-round to keep residents safe, cared for, and engaged.

    Meals come freshly prepared by a professional chef and kitchen staff, using organic ingredients, with daily meal service and all-day dining. Special diets can be accommodated, including diabetes-friendly and allergy-sensitive meals, and family support helps loved ones feel connected and informed. Activities are part of daily life, with outings, games, art workshops, exercise classes, and weekly entertainment, and there are places like a movie theater, spa, sauna, wellness center, fitness programs, and a calendar full of social and physical activities. There's a library, arts room, music programs, and outdoor walking paths to keep minds and bodies active. For comfort and convenience, maintenance-free living is standard, with staff taking care of all chores, so residents can focus on hobbies, connecting with others, and enjoying their days.

    Transportation and parking are provided, including rides to doctor's appointments, and there's an option for pet-friendly living. The residence is fully licensed by the NYS Department of Health, and everything is accessible for those with mobility needs. Staff encourages independence and individuality, and the environment's set up to reflect the feeling of a private home while still offering plenty of support and amenities for seniors who need them. Home of the Good Shepherd - Malta operates as a non-profit, and it's received positive reviews for compassionate, pro-active staff and award-winning activity programs. The community offers a safe, kind place for seniors looking for assisted living, enhanced care, or memory care, with a flexible setup allowing each person to find a routine and support that fits their stage of life.

    No, Home of the Good Shepherd – Malta does not offer respite care. Respite care in assisted living communities provides temporary, short-term relief for primary caregivers by offering professional care for their loved ones. It allows individuals to stay in an assisted living community for a limited time, giving caregivers a break while ensuring residents receive necessary support and assistance with daily activities.
